ACQUISITION OR DISPOSITION OF ASSETS (a) On April 30, 2003, the Registrant sold all of the outstanding stock of Meteor Enterprises, Inc. ("Meteor") to Sedco, Inc. The closing was effective as of January 1, 2003. Meteor is the petroleum marketing and distribution segment of the Registrant doing business in New Mexico, Colorado, Wyoming, South Dakota, Nevada, Utah, Montana, Nebraska and Idaho. The sales price was $2,500,000 and 4,000,000 shares of Network Fueling Corp. ("NFC") as follows: a) $300,000 previously loaned to Registrant by Purchaser will be applied to purchase price as a non-refundable portion of the purchase price. b) A $1,200,000 promissory note, bearing interest at the annual rate of 7%. The note will be due on April 30, 2004. Interest payments will be due on the first day of each month until paid, beginning June 1, 2003. c) A $1,000,000 promissory note, bearing interest at the annual rate of 7%. The note will be due on October 31,2003. Interest payments will be due on the first day of each month until paid, beginning June 1, 2003. d) 4,000,000 shares of NFC representing 36.3% of the total outstanding stock of NFC. The President and director of the Registrant, Ilyas Chaudhary, is the sole shareholder of Sedco Energy, Inc. The amount of consideration received was determined based on negotiations between the parties. The sale is subject to a fairness opinion being obtained. If the fairness opinion states the transaction is not fair to Registrant the transaction can be terminated and the $300,000 already received would be retained by Registrant. The transaction was approved by the Board of Directors of Registrant at a meeting held on April 30, 2003. April 30, 2003 PURCHASE AGREEMENT THIS PURCHASE AGREEMENT, is made as of April 30, 2003, between Sedco, Inc. ("Purchaser") and Capco Energy, Inc. ("Seller"). WHEREAS, Seller owns 100% of the total capital of Meteor Enterprises, Inc. (the "Asset"); WHEREAS, Purchaser desires to acquire and Seller desires to sell all of its interest in the Asset in exchange for the consideration and upon the terms described herein (the "Purchase"); and WHEREAS, Purchaser and Seller desire to make certain representations, warranties, covenants and agreements in connection with the Purchase; NOW THEREFORE, in consideration of the mutual promises, covenants, provisions and representations contained herein, the parties hereto agree as follows: ARTICLE I THE PURCHASE 1.1 Sale and Delivery of Asset. Subject to all the terms and conditions of this Agreement, Seller shall sell, transfer, convey, assign and deliver to Purchaser at the Closing (as defined in paragraph 1.3 hereof) and Purchaser shall purchase, acquire and accept from the Seller the Asset. 1.2 Effective Date and Closing. The effective date (the "Effective Date") of this transaction shall be January 1, 2003. Closing of this transaction shall be April 30, 2003. 1.3 Purchase Price. Subject to all of the terms and conditions set forth in the Agreement and in reliance on the representations, warranties and covenants hereinafter set forth, Purchaser shall deliver to Seller $2,500,000 and 4,000,000 shares of Network Fueling Corp. ("NFC") (hereinafter referred to as the "Purchase Price"), at closing, as follows: a) $300,000 previously loaned to Seller by Purchaser will be applied to purchase price as a non-refundable portion of the purchase price. b) A $1,200,000 promissory note, ("Note 1") bearing interest at the annual rate of 7%. The note will be due on April 30, 2004. Interest payments will be due on the first day of each month until paid, beginning June 1, 2003. c) A $1,000,000 promissory note, ("Note 2") bearing interest at the annual rate of 7%. The note will be due on October 31,2003. Interest payments will be due on the first day of each month until paid, beginning June 1, 2003. d) As additional security to Note 1 and Note 2 Purchaser shall deposit 3,000,000 shares of Sellers common stock with the Corporate Secretary of Seller. e) 4,000,000 shares of NFC representing 36.3% of the total outstanding stock of NFC. f) Purchaser will obtain releases of all guarantees and co borrowings of Seller related to the Asset within 90 days. ARTICLE IV COVENANTS 4.1 Release of Obligations. Purchaser shall have released Seller of all obligations, contingent or otherwise, relating to or in any way connected to or with the Asset. 4.2 Indemnification by Purchaser. Purchaser agrees to indemnify, defend and hold harmless Seller, and the respective officers, representatives, agents, employees of Seller and successors and assigns of the Seller from and against: (1) Any and all losses resulting from any guarantees or co-borrowings by the Seller of any liabilities of Meteor Enterprises or its subsidiaries, and any misrepresentation or breach of any representation or warranty or non-fulfillment of any covenant or agreement on the part of Purchaser under the terms of this Agreement; (2) Any liability or assessment relating to any losses (including tax liability or assessment) related to Seller or this Agreement or the transactions contemplated hereby; (3) All actions, suits, proceedings, arbitration's, demands, assessments, judgments, costs and expenses, including attorney's fees and disbursements, incident to the foregoing; and (4) All claims, demands, losses, costs, expenses, obligations, liabilities, damages, recoveries and deficiencies, including interest, penalties, and reasonable attorney fees, that they shall incur or suffer, which result from or relate to any activities of the subsidiaries of Meteor Enterprises, Inc. or Purchaser prior to, on or subsequent to the Closing Date or which result from or relate to any breach of, or failure by Purchaser to perform any of its representations, warranties, covenants or agreements in this Agreement or in any schedule, certificate, exhibit or other instrument furnished or to be furnished by Purchaser under this Agreement. 4.3 Fairness Opinion Seller shall obtain a Fairness Opinion from an Investment Banker or third party assessment company before July 31, 2003. In the event the Fairness Opinion rendered indicates this transaction is not fair then the transaction shall be rescinded and the Stock shall be returned to Seller and all consideration, except the $300,000 non-refundable portion, shall be returned to the Purchaser.
